OnePlus India Confirms OnePlus N6x Features eMMC 5.1 Storage Instead of UFS 2.2

Clarification on OnePlus N6x Storage Specifications
In a recent statement, OnePlus India Support decisively clarified the storage specifications of the OnePlus N6x smartphone. The company confirmed that the device features eMMC 5.1 storage, dispelling rumors and misleading claims suggesting that it is equipped with UFS 2.2. This clarification aims to set the record straight and prevent potential consumer confusion.
Understanding the Storage Types
To better understand the significance of this clarification, it's essential to differentiate between the two types of storage mentioned:
- eMMC 5.1: Embedded MultiMediaCard, often used in budget devices, provides decent performance but is generally slower than UFS. It is typically adequate for everyday tasks but may not provide the speed necessary for intensive applications.
- UFS 2.2: Universal Flash Storage, a newer technology that allows for faster read and write speeds compared to eMMC. It is often found in higher-end smartphones, enhancing performance for gaming, multitasking, and data-intensive applications.
Misleading Claims Addressed
With the announcement of the OnePlus N6x, a confusion arose regarding its storage capabilities. Some sources inaccurately stated that the device was fitted with UFS 2.2 storage. OnePlus India promptly addressed these claims, emphasizing that they never made any official statement supporting the notion of UFS 2.2 for the N6x 5G model.
